What is infertility?
Infertility is a reproductive condition where couples cannot conceive, while actively trying, for more than a year. It affects 1 in 6 people, and yes, it impacts men and women equally. Where 50% of infertility cases are as a result of male infertility and 50% to female infertility (World Health Organization; 2023).
But still, male infertility often gets overlooked.
What causes male infertility?
There isn’t one simple answer. It’s different for everyone. Some common causes include:
🧬Age, genetics, hormone imbalances, and lifestyle factors
💊Certain medications or health conditions,
❓And sometimes, there is no clear answer at all.

When should you seek infertility assistance?
If you have been trying to conceive for over a year without success, it’s worth speaking to a professional. Even for healthy couples aged 29-33, there is only a 20-25% chance of conceiving per month, this increases to 60% over 6 months (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, 2024).
How is infertility treated?
The good news is that most cases (85–90%) can be treated with medication or straightforward procedures.
Only a small percentage (under 3%) require more advanced treatment like IVF (xx).
✨1 in 7 babies today are born through fertility treatments.
✨Only 6% of infertility cases in men are a sign of something more serious.
✨IVF success rates using donor s***m are approximately 51% per cycle, offering a hopeful path to fatherhood for many men facing fertility challenges
(American Journal of Obstetrics and Gynecology, 2017).
